Citikey Free Business Directory
Register Free
Add
{{#signedin}}
{{/signedin}} {{^signedin}}
{{/signedin}}
{{#items}}
{{name}}
{{section}}
{{/items}}
Internet Cafes in Lower Clapton, London
Alkheyrat
Lower Clapton Road, Lower Clapton, London E5 0QR
Clapton Internet Cafe
Lower Clapton Road, Lower Clapton, London E5 8EG
Borro Telecom Shop
Upper Clapton Road, Lower Clapton, London E5 9BU
Abbey International
Chatsworth Road, Lower Clapton, London E5 0LP